Abstract
A waste container for a blood analyzer or other fluid analysis medical device. The waste container includes a flexible waste bag having a gas vent that may include a gas permeable, but substantially fluid impermeable, material or fabric. The fabric allows gases to escape the waste bag, but substantially prevents fluids from escaping. The waste container also includes a moisture absorbent material, such as a polyacrylamide polymer, that converts waste fluid, such as blood, from the blood analyzer into a substantially solid material, such as a gel, as waste fluids enter the waste bag. As waste fluids enter the waste bag and are converted into a substantially solid material, expelled gases that form in the waste bag as well as gases entering the waste bag from the blood analyzer pass through the gas vent. The waste container can be used with a blood analyzer that analyzes blood gases and electrolytes.

11. A waste container for a portable blood analyzer, comprising:
-
a. a flexible waste bag that prevents any appreciable amount of fluid from escaping, coupled to the portable blood analyzer by an inlet port that engages a fluid fitting on the analyzer, for receiving waste fluid from the portable blood analyzer, the flexible waste bag having a gas vent for allowing gases but not any appreciable amount of fluid to escape the flexible waste bag; b. means, contained in the waste bag, for converting waste blood from the portable blood analyzer into a gel as waste blood enters the waste bag, thereby causing the waste bag to expand as the waste fluid is converted within the waste bag; and c. a self-sealing valve that seals the flexible waste bag against the escape of fluids when the inlet port is disengaged from the fluid fitting. - View Dependent Claims (12)

13. A disposable waste container for a blood analyzer, comprising:
-
a. a flexible expandable waste bag that prevents any appreciable amount of fluids from escaping, coupled to the blood analyzer by an inlet port that engages a fluid fitting on the analyzer, having a top and a bottom when the waste bag is properly positioned in the blood analyzer and having an inlet port located at the bottom of the waste bag and a gas vent located at the top of the waste bag; b. a moisture absorbent material contained in the waste bag for converting waste blood from the portable blood analyzer into a gel, thereby causing the waste bag to expand as waste blood enters the waste bag through the inlet port and is converted within the waste bag; c. the gas vent including a gas-permeable and fluid-impermeable material for allowing gases but not any appreciable amount of fluid to escape the waste bag; and d. a self-sealing valve that seals the flexible waste bag against the escape of fluids when the inlet port is disengaged from the fluid fitting. - View Dependent Claims (14)
